Compare Fractal Design North Momentum Black vs Corsair Carbide 100R Silent Edition

Fractal Design North Momentum Black and Corsair Carbide 100R Silent Edition are both cases with the same Motherboard Compatibility (ATX, Micro ATX, Mini ITX) and Expansion Slots (7). The main differences are in External 5.25" Drive Bays, Internal 2.5" Drive Bays, Internal 3.5" Drive Bays and Front Panel I/O.

Comparison and key differences summary

Reasons to buy the Fractal Design North Momentum Black:

  • Newer Product, it was released around 11 years later
  • +2 internal 2.5" bays
  • Additional VGA length allowance (+80.00mm)
  • Supports the following front panel USB ports: USB 3.2 Gen 2 Type C
  • Moderately more space available (+10% total case volume)

Reasons to buy the Corsair Carbide 100R Silent Edition:

  • 64% cheaper, you can save $115.00
  • +2 external 5.25" bays
  • +2 internal 3.5" bays
